5. Regularly Asked QuestionsQ1: What is the common period of a railroad settlement procedure? A1: The duration can differ commonly depending on the complexity of the problems at hand, varying from a couple of months to numerous years. Q2: Who are the main stakeholders associated with railroad settlements? A2: Stakeholders consist of railroad business, local municipalities, government regulators, community advocates, and in some cases labor unions. Q3: Can railroad settlements be publically accessed? A3: Many settlements are public documents unless they include private settlements or confidential matters. Q4: How can communities affect railroad Settlement rad settlements? A4: Communities can participate in advocacy, go to public hearings, and collaborate with regional officials to voice their concerns and desires. Q5: What occurs if a railroad stops working to comply with a settlement agreement? A5: Failing to stick to a settlement can result in legal action, extra penalties, or the imposition of tighter regulative controls. 6.
